AT&T layoffs: 12,000 staff to go

Under: News, Phone Business & Stocks
Date: December 4th, 2008

AT&T (NYSE:T) the American Telecoms giant announced today they will lay off 12,000 of its staff due to recent economic conditions. This equates to 4 percent of its total workforce losing their jobs.

AT T are also reducing its capital expenditures for 2009, full information on the reductions will be stated in the telecommunications companies Q4 earnings posted in late January.

$600 million will be allocated to pay severance pay to those members of staff affected by the job cuts. AT&T announced that they will continue to add jobs in other areas such as video and broadband and wireless.

The Dallas, Texas-based company had said that the cuts will take start in December and through 2009.
